Understanding Trading Pairs
What is Pairs Trading?
Pairs trading involves simultaneously buying and selling two correlated securities to profit from their relative movements. This market-neutral strategy aims to capture the spread between the two securities, regardless of market direction.
Key Concepts
- Correlation: The degree to which two securities move in relation to each other.
- Spread: The price difference between the two securities.
- Mean Reversion: The tendency of the spread to revert to its historical average.
Why Trade Pairs?
Pairs trading offers several advantages, including reduced market risk, consistent returns, and the ability to profit in both rising and falling markets.
Components of a Pairs Trading Strategy
Selecting Pairs
Choosing the right pairs is crucial for successful pairs trading.
Criteria for Pair Selection
- High Correlation: Select pairs with a strong historical correlation.
- Liquidity: Ensure both securities are highly liquid to facilitate easy entry and exit.
- Fundamental Similarity: Choose pairs within the same industry or sector to maintain a fundamental relationship.
Analyzing the Spread
Monitoring and analyzing the spread between the selected pairs is essential.
Statistical Tools
- Standard Deviation: Measure the dispersion of the spread to identify trading opportunities.
- Z-Score: Calculate the Z-score to determine how far the spread is from its mean.
- Cointegration: Test for cointegration to ensure a stable long-term relationship between the pairs.
Entry and Exit Points
Identifying precise entry and exit points is key to maximizing profits.
Entry Criteria
- Deviations from the Mean: Enter trades when the spread deviates significantly from its mean.
- Z-Score Thresholds: Use Z-score thresholds (e.g., ±2) to signal entry points.
Exit Criteria
- Mean Reversion: Exit trades when the spread reverts to its mean.
- Profit Targets: Set profit targets based on historical spread movements.
- Stop-Loss Orders: Use stop-loss orders to limit potential losses.
Risk Management in Pairs Trading
Importance of Risk Management
Effective risk management is crucial to protect your capital and ensure long-term success.
Techniques for Managing Risk
- Position Sizing: Risk a fixed percentage of your trading capital on each pair.
- Diversification: Trade multiple pairs to spread risk.
- Stop-Loss Orders: Implement stop-loss orders to limit potential losses.
Hedging Strategies
Pairs trading inherently involves hedging since you are long one security and short the other.
Benefits of Hedging
- Reduced Market Risk: Mitigates exposure to market movements.
- Consistent Returns: Provides steady returns in various market conditions.
